I'd rather not call this the Black Pearl for the inaccuracies it has. The mentioned number of masts is a big difference. Also I really like your idea of solving the back under the cabin, but it really looks nothing like the Pearl. it's awesome for a generic ship though and as such it's a very good build! I'd also really like to see a Pearl with an accurate long cabin version. If you look at the side view of the Pearl, the cabin part + the fence for stairs and additional cannons is almost 1/3 of the hull length.

I'll try to make my version, but need to bricklink some more sails and the black hull middle parts. I'm not buying two sets for just a few parts ... hope to post my solution in a near future.

Thanks for the comments, I'll take them into consideration as I rebuild and modify. The extra mast is an issue but I included it as some models of the pearl have a third mast close to the helm and the my ship design didn't allow for that. The shorter and longer cabin length is something that could be improved as well.

The extra ship cost was alleviated by selling the crew off on eBay since they seem to be selling well right now.
